A very cold Saturday morning in Southall saw two Goodgymers running to Mrs S' to help her spruce up her garden.

The task at hand was to cut the grass, clear the leaves and weed the flower beds.

Mollie got to work clearing the leaves as I mowed the grass, then we both joined up to clear the numerous weeds scattered around the edges of the garden.

An hour later and with a bin full of grass, leaves and weeds, we said our goodbyes and separated into the lovely morning sunshine.
